LPI 701-200: Your Gateway to DevOps Mastery

LPI 701-200, known as the LPI DevOps Tools Engineer - 701 certification, is designed for IT professionals seeking to validate their expertise in modern DevOps methodologies and tools. This credential from LPI specifically targets individuals who orchestrate and automate the software development lifecycle, emphasizing critical skills in system management, containerization, CI/CD pipelines, and infrastructure as code. Identifying Core Study Areas
Although specific exam objectives aren't detailed in the inputs, a strong LPI DevOps Tools Engineer candidate would typically focus on areas like:
- Version Control Systems: Proficiency with Git, including branching, merging, and collaborative workflows.
- CI/CD Tools: Understanding tools like Jenkins, GitLab CI, or similar for automating build, test, and deployment pipelines.
- Containerization: Deep knowledge of Docker concepts, image building, container orchestration with tools like Kubernetes.
- Infrastructure as Code (IaC): Familiarity with tools such as Ansible, Terraform, or Puppet for automating infrastructure provisioning.
- Monitoring and Logging: Implementing solutions for system health checks, performance metrics, and centralized log management.
- Scripting and Automation: Developing scripts (e.g., Bash, Python) to automate routine tasks and integrate various tools.
- Cloud Platforms: Basic understanding of how DevOps principles apply to major cloud providers.
These areas represent the typical scope of a DevOps Tools Engineer and should guide your study efforts, aligning with LPI's exam 701 objectives.
